Which size would that be? :P

The sources I've seen for the Eclipse's length says that it's either 17.6km long or twice the length of the Executor. Since the Executor has three different lengths recorded, this puts the Eclipse at 16km, 25.6km or 35.2km.

An ISD is 1.6km, which is 17.6km when multiplied by 11... I assume you consider the 17.6km length to be the Executor's canon length. There are compelling arguments in favour and against this - being featured in the movies and being so very lightly armed for its size*.

Wookieepedia puts the Eclipse at 17.5km long, so it *is* nearly 11 times the length of an ISD. :P

*The Executor is reputed to be armed with something like 250 turbolaser batteries, 250 ion cannon batteries and 250 concussion missile launchers. This is a ridiculously low amount of firepower when compared with the ISD's 60 turbolaser batteries and 60 ion cannon batteries. Assuming weapon armanent is proportional to length(which it is not, width has to be factored in), 11*60 equals 660. Given that the Executor masses more than thirty or fifty times the ISD, it should be armed with between 1800-3000 turbolaser batteries, 1800-3000 turbolaser batteries as well as however many warhead launchers would have been seen as appropiate. Certainly in the four-digit range, if the Providence-class Carrier/Destroyer is anything to judge by - 102 torpedo launchers in a hull massing much less than an ISD.
